首页 > 编程知识 正文

微信管理系统怎么登录,管理平台登录 user

时间:2023-05-06 06:09:03 阅读:41825 作者:4684

1 .完成登录功能1.1重置表单第一步:向表单中添加refel-form ref=' loginform '/El-form第二步:向重置按钮中添加和重置事件//重置表单reset form ((this.$ refs.loginform.reset fields ) ) 1.2表单预验证) /用户登录loginIn ) ) /验证表单的整体合法性} 1.3封装登录接口封装方法参考微信封装

1.3.1包环境地址const env={ //在线环境prod : { base URL : ' https://www.liulongbin.top :888 ' }、//开发环境dev : (base URL :65https://www.dev.top :8888//测试环境test :65https://www.test.top 33591.3. 2 /elmentUI组件import { message } from ' element-ui '//env.js import部署axios实例constservice=axios.create (/axios $ ) baseURL.prod.baseURL )/API/private/V1 `,tiivate //添加请求拦截service.interceptors.request.use (功能(cocon ) config ) if ) config.URL=='/login ' ) {//获取token并传递给请求标头的const token=session storage.getitem (' token ) /配置请求标头if 、函数(error )//请求错误returnpromise.reject(error ); ); //请求响应侦听返回service.interceptors.response.use (function (response ) console.log )响应侦听:',response ) constres ) 204 ]轻型提示if (resultok.includes (RES.meta.status )/message ) (message3360RES.matus ) )的type : ' success ' 请检查();function(error )//失败为returnpromise.reject ) error ); ); 导出默认服务; 1.3.3项目接口import request from './request'//包注册接口exportfunctionlogin(data ) returnrequest ) {URL:

1 .需求认证页面通常通过路由设置元

2 .路由保护:阻止跳转路由的元是否为自动标记

1.3.4记住上次访问的地址,登录后,再次返回上次访问的想法。 跳转到登录页面时,要访问的页面地址作为参数传递到登录页面,登录成功后,返回原始页码。

//卫士router.beforeeach((to,from,next )={console.log ) ' to: ),to//第一步: let flag=to.matched.) token () returnnext ) (/跳跃的根path: )/login ),具有通过/query传递的参数,query是对象query: ) redirect : to . 保持不变(next () else (next ) ) } )放入组件中。 let(redirect )=this.$ route.query this.$ router.push ) path 3360重定向ect

el-header

el-aside :解决溢出问题,去掉el-menu的右侧边框

. el-menu { border-right:none; } el-main

el-footer

EL菜单

el-header注销想法:第一步:清除token的第二步:跳转到登录页

版权声明:该文观点仅代表作者本人。处理文章:请发送邮件至 三1五14八八95#扣扣.com 举报,一经查实,本站将立刻删除。